In this impressive book, Tieting Su questions the consensus that globalization is a defining characteristic of the world economic system in general and the world trading system in particular. Most studies have examined globalization as it stands today - this book charts its prehistory. World trade networks are put under the microscope along with trading blocs and business cycles in a book that is a valuable resource not only for students of economics, but also of politics and sociology.
